The similarities of Buddhism to other religions falls off shortly after the concept that people can improve themselves and make themselves better. Unlike other religions Buddhism:

  • has no god(s)
  • has no set o do's and don'ts like the ten commandments
  • has no judgment day
  • has no creation myth
  • has no prayers for help or intervention
  • let's people find their own path though lfe

Is the Vedas writings of the Buddha?

No, the Vedas are ancient sacred texts in Hinduism, while the Buddha was the founder of Buddhism. The teachings and beliefs found in the Vedas are different from those taught by the Buddha.
